The invention discloses a moisture migration test device and method under the combined action of a temperature and a humidity field, and solves the problem that only a humidity field is analyzed and the accuracy of a test result is influenced in the prior art; the moisture migration test device is simple in structure, convenient to operate and capable of obtaining the moisture migration rule and strength evolution under the combined action of the temperature and the humidity, and the scheme is as follows: the moisture migration test device under the combined action of the temperature and the humidity field comprises a water tank, a sample barrel and a thermostat, wherein colored water can be contained in the water tank; a soil sample can be arranged in the sample barrel, the bottom of thesample barrel is inserted into the water tank, and the bottom of the sample barrel can be immersed in the colored water in the water tank; a humidity sensor and a bending element, which can be inserted into the soil sample, are arranged on the side part of the sample barrel; and the thermostat is arranged at the top of the sample barrel, and a heating element is arranged in the thermostat.
